Because your request is related to compensation/service credits, the appropriate channel is Microsoft Support. Please kindly follow these steps below:
- Visit to this link: Contact - Microsoft Support > Select Outlook
- Select Get home support
- Type your issue (use correct keyword to reach live chat support) > select Get help
- Scroll down and find Contact Support
- At the box Select your product or service
- At the box Select your product category
- After that you select Chat with a support agent in your web browser
To proceed, please contact Microsoft Support and share the Microsoft Support ticket number, this helps save time by allowing a quicker review of the case history and incident details, and reduces the need to re-collect the same information.
